Transaction 75dfd853f19352d5cbcbfdce490ea9176859855fe02c76cf361cff99135a25ee
1 Input
2 Outputs
- 75dfd853f19352d5cbcbfdce490ea9176859855fe02c76cf361cff99135a25ee:0
- 75dfd853f19352d5cbcbfdce490ea9176859855fe02c76cf361cff99135a25ee:1
value 242304
address 16samxwHWohCSmYpgVaRZarFPD9wNKGw8W
value 35345846
address 17oFf7Be5L4EDNW4jjUR865fK45XKwnjAX